Output 62f0308027d414840c573b4177eb7b49648bc8020f1c4ede36d56535c21ba63e:1

value
435835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c044bf9a3e9c439ef0870fe90635b98b2cd5b5a OP_EQUAL
address
3QfZMRv588JTfFpifPJKwsoyRDCRHdeXTZ
transaction
62f0308027d414840c573b4177eb7b49648bc8020f1c4ede36d56535c21ba63e